#a4c632 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a4c632 is composed of 64.3% red, 77.6%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.7%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 73.8 degrees, a saturation of 59.7% and a lightness of 48.6%. #a4c632 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ff64 with #498d00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#a4c632
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080a03 is the darkest color, while #fdfef9 is the lightest one.
